Organizational Context
The United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ime (UNODC) is seeking a Law Enforcement Expert to support the Counter-Terrorist Travel Programme (CTTP). This role will focus on enhancing Member States' capabilities in using Advanced Passenger Information (API) and Passenger Name Record (PNR) data for law enforcement purposes, contributing to global security efforts.
Job Purpose
The purpose of this role is to plan and organize capacity-building activities focused on the effective use and analysis of API/PNR data for law enforcement. This includes coordinating training curricula, developing materials, and delivering training sessions to government agencies, particularly Passenger Information Units (PIUs). The role aims to strengthen Member States' abilities to detect and counter terrorists and serious criminals by promoting an intelligence-led approach to risk assessment, targeting, and information exchange, in line with international security resolutions and privacy laws.
Responsibilities
The consultant will coordinate the design and delivery of training curricula and materials on API/PNR data use for law enforcement, including in-person and online sessions. They will provide capacity-building assistance to government agencies, especially PIUs, and support the development of e-learning tools. The role involves leading organizational studies and exchange visits for PIUs, facilitating expert deployments, and fostering cooperation among PIUs globally. Additionally, the consultant will organize operational working groups to assess capacity-building needs, support national authorities in establishing PIUs, and facilitate the exchange of best practices and lessons learned among Member States. This includes assisting in drafting operational documentation such as Terms of Reference and Standards of Procedure.
